About Lake George

Lake George, known as the 'Queen of the American Lakes,' is a stunning glacial lake in the Adirondack Mountains of New York. It offers a blend of natural beauty, outdoor activities, and historic charm, making it a popular destination for nature lovers, families, and history enthusiasts.

Day trips

Saratoga Springs
35 km (22 miles) • Half day to full day

A charming town known for its historic horse racing track and mineral springs.

Ausable Chasm
40 km (25 miles) • Half day

A stunning granite gorge offering hiking, rafting, and scenic views.
